The Verizon Mobile Security Index 2021 found that 76% of respondents experienced pressure to sacrifice mobile security for expediency. Nearly all the apps we see can be compromised within 15 minutes. Hackers use open source, freely available disassemblers, decompilers, and debuggers to reverse engineer mobile apps and understand the source code.
